GETTING THERE Getting to Scotland and the West Highlands is easy by train There are fast and frequent train services from all parts of Britain to Glasgow Central. Trains to Oban, Fort William and Mallaig depart from Glasgow Queen Street and there is a shuttle bus linking the two stations.
